Abstract

Agriculture is a livelihood for the people of Indonesia. Agriculture in Indonesia is carried out in a traditional system and carried out on makeshift land. The problem that is often experienced by farmers is the problem of irrigation such as being unable to check and control irrigation systems and one of the most important factors in increasing agricultural production. Irrigation is the activity of giving water to agricultural land with the aim of making the soil wetter so that the roots of plants grow well. To help farmers in conducting irrigation, WSN technology is needed to control and check irrigation systems. In this modern era the application of netwrok wireless sensors has greatly increased, given its ability to distribute and disseminate data wirelessly. In this study will make an irrigation system using a wireless sensor network to facilitate farmers in conducting irrigation. By using Arduino Uno as a microcontroller to process data, ultrasonic sensors for reading distance or high, servo as open doorstop, NRF24L01 as communication between nodes and bluetooth is used for communication with Android. The test results that have been carried out by this system can run as desired where each node can communicate with each other, servo works well can open and close water channels and ultrasonic sensors are able to detect water levels. From the results of the experiment processing time of 15 times land 1 to land 3 or land 3 and land 1 is 524.66 ms and from land 2 to land 3 or land 3 to land 2 is 405.33 ms.
